<div dir="ltr">Hello. Recently, I have started a new project to
explore Babylon code reflection API (LInq), and thought that
using sealed classes to represent operand type would be really
suitable (function calls, column refs etc.). However, I want to
only expose one interface/abstract class for each of those
types, while actual implementations are private classes inside
sealed classes. However, when I tried to compile something like
this (simplified for brevity):
<div><br>
</div>
<div>
<pre style="color:rgb(188,190,196);font-family:"JetBrains Mono",monospace"><span style="color:rgb(207,142,109)">sealed class </span>Tmp <span style="color:rgb(207,142,109)">permits </span>Tmp.A {
<span style="color:rgb(207,142,109)">private static final class </span>A <span style="color:rgb(207,142,109)">extends </span>Tmp {
}
}</pre>
<pre style="color:rgb(188,190,196);font-family:"JetBrains Mono",monospace">
</pre>
<pre style=""><span style="background-color:rgb(243,243,243)"><font color="#000000" style="" face="arial, sans-serif">I got following error:</font></span></pre>
<pre style="">error: A has private access in Tmp</pre>
<pre style="">
</pre>
<pre style=""><font face="arial, sans-serif">Is this behaviour expected or not?
(I would assume second since intellij code analysis didn't mark this as error)
If it's later, I would ask some JDK member to file a bug report (I noticed that they
are processed faster then non-member requests), and I will try to fix this. If it`s
premier, then what is the motivation behind this?</font></pre>
